Output 3348578ed7a319d62c8808fc7d686da6d9d34e5c7f15b2330261a8c97f6654bd:1

value
405143
script pubkey
OP_0 OP_PUSHBYTES_20 2d70f0e0ed99bd87f4b71f76cfda948806b90609
address
bc1q94c0pc8dnx7c0a9hramvlk553qrtjpsftylg3a
transaction
3348578ed7a319d62c8808fc7d686da6d9d34e5c7f15b2330261a8c97f6654bd
spent
true